1. Mindful Eating: Nutrition as Brain Fuel
Transform breakfast from a rushed affair into a brain-boosting ritual. Mindful eating means slowing down to notice flavors, textures, and how food makes your body feel. This practice not only improves digestion but also strengthens your brain's ability to focus throughout the day. Research shows that mindful eating reduces stress hormones while enhancing nutrient absorption—a perfect healthy life healthy mind combination.
Try this: Before your first bite, take three deep breaths. Notice the colors and aromas of your food. Chew thoroughly and pause between bites. This simple ritual transforms a biological necessity into a moment of presence.
2. Movement Microbursts: Energize Body and Mind
Brief movement breaks throughout your morning dramatically enhance cognitive function. Even 3-5 minutes of stretching, walking, or basic exercises increases blood flow to the brain, improving mental clarity and emotional regulation. These microbursts serve as powerful stress reduction techniques while simultaneously strengthening your body.
Morning movement doesn't require elaborate workouts—simply stretch for 60 seconds after waking, take a brisk 5-minute walk, or do 10 jumping jacks before your shower. Your brain and body will thank you.

1. Nature Exposure: Green Space for Mental Space
Even brief exposure to natural environments reduces cortisol levels while improving mood and cognitive function. Evening is the perfect time to incorporate this healthy life healthy mind practice. Spend 10-15 minutes outdoors—whether walking through a park, sitting beneath a tree, or tending to houseplants.
The practice of "forest bathing" originated in Japan and is now recognized worldwide for its powerful effects on anxiety management and immune function. No forest nearby? Even looking at nature photographs has measurable benefits.
2. Digital Boundaries: Tech-Life Balance
Creating intentional boundaries with technology is essential for emotional equilibrium. The constant stimulation from screens disrupts both sleep cycles and attention spans. Implement a 30-60 minute screen-free buffer before bedtime to signal to your brain that it's time to transition to rest.
Replace scrolling with a calming activity that nurtures your healthy life healthy mind connection—perhaps light stretching, reading a physical book, or sipping herbal tea while listening to gentle music.
3. Sleep Hygiene: Optimizing Rest for Recovery
Quality sleep is perhaps the most powerful healthy life healthy mind practice available. During deep sleep, your brain clears waste products while your body repairs tissues. Consistent sleep timing, a cool dark room, and a calming pre-sleep routine dramatically improve both physical recovery and mental clarity.
The most effective approach is maintaining consistent sleep and wake times, even on weekends. This regularity helps optimize your circadian rhythm for both physical and cognitive performance.
